On Thursday, March 14th, 2002, Dave Caruso offered a songwriting workshop for the students of Boyd Arthurs Middle School in Trenton, MI.

The clinic lasted all day as Dave spoke to each of the 6th-, 7th-, and 8th-grade band and choir classes at the school he once attended.

Dave used tracks which were pre-recorded and loaded onto his portable MP3 player to demonstrate how a song can be enhanced into fuller arrangements.  The kids were asked to identify all of the instruments used in the backing track.
Explanations were punctuated by demonstration.  Some of the students also got the chance to write a song on the spot with Dave.  Lyric ideas were jotted down on the board as suggested by members of the class. For their theme, they chose "a day off from school."  After the main ideas were collected, Dave explained how the ideas might be expanded and organized.  The class chose a title, "Snow Day."  After the song was completed, Dave sang the finished product.

Dave shared some of his original music, including his latest, "Big Dark Secret," on which Boyd Arthurs Band Director Peter Kopera accompanied Dave on piano.

At the end of each class, Dave fielded questions about songwriting from the students.  A few asked for autographs.
